RAMBAN: The Department of AYUSH Ramban under the guidance of Deputy Commissioner Mohammad Alyas Khan, celebrated the 10th Ayurveda Day, which coincides with Dhanwantari Jayanti, engaging the community in honoring India’s ancient health system. The event observed on Dhanteras, paid tribute to Lord Dhanwantari, the deity of Ayurveda and highlighted the significance of traditional health practices.
Chief Planning Officer Dr. Shakeeb Ahmed Rather was the chief guest on the occasion. The programme was attended by the officers, officials and locals. In his address, CPO emphasized Ayurveda's essential role in modern healthcare, encouraging the community to integrate Ayurvedic principles into their daily lives for holistic well-being and disease prevention.
The celebration included enriching lectures by Doctors; Ayush Health Workers, emphasizing Ayurveda’s benefits for boosting immunity and managing lifestyle diseases. District Yoga Coordinator and Senior AYUSH Officer Dr. Masood Iqbal Zarger expressed appreciation for the community's participation and reiterated AYUSH’s commitment to promoting Ayurveda. Dr Masood Zarger concluded the event with a vote of thanks, underscoring this celebration as part of a national movement to revive Ayurveda as a sustainable healthcare approach.
